Cystic Fibrosis Therapeutics Market Analysis

 

The Cystic Fibrosis Therapeutics Market is projected to reach US$ 15.42 billion by 2032, up from US$ 7.07 billion in 2023, with a CAGR of 9.04% from 2024 to 2032.

 

Cystic Fibrosis, a well-known genetic disease, is caused by mutations within the CFTR gene, affecting the lungs and digestive system. This disease interferes with the function of the CFTR ion channel, which plays a crucial role in regulating the flow across the cell membrane. The CFTR gene is located on chromosome 7, and this condition has a global impact, affecting various organ systems worldwide. In the United States alone, there are over 30,000 individuals affected, with a worldwide incidence exceeding 70,000.

The symptoms of cystic fibrosis can include persistent coughing, wheezing, shortness of breath, digestive issues, and poor growth. However, with the appropriate medication, therapy, and lifestyle adjustments, it is possible to effectively manage this condition. While there is currently no cure, extensive research and development efforts are ongoing to discover a permanent solution for this debilitating health condition. In March 2024, The Cystic Fibrosis Foundation committed over $6.6 million to Sionna Therapeutics for research into new modulator recovery methods.

 

 

Growth drivers of the Cystic Fibrosis (CF) therapeutics market

 

Advancements in Treatment Options: Continuous research and development efforts are pivotal in advancing therapies for Cystic Fibrosis (CF), leading to the introduction of novel treatments such as CFTR modulators and gene therapies. CFTR modulators target specific genetic mutations underlying CF, aiming to restore or improve the function of the defective CFTR protein. These therapies represent a significant advancement over traditional symptomatic treatments, offering the potential to address the root cause of CF and improve outcomes for patients. Gene therapies, on the other hand, aim to correct faulty genes responsible for CF, potentially providing long-term benefits by addressing the genetic basis of the disease. The introduction of these innovative therapies expands treatment options for CF patients, offering hope for improved quality of life and disease management in the future.

 

Rising Disease Awareness and Diagnosis: Increased awareness about Cystic Fibrosis (CF) and advancements in diagnostic techniques play crucial roles in driving market growth through early detection and treatment initiation. As awareness campaigns educate the public and healthcare professionals about CF symptoms and risk factors, more cases are identified earlier in the disease progression. Improved diagnostic tools, such as genetic testing and newborn screening programs, enable swift and accurate diagnosis, facilitating prompt intervention and treatment initiation. Early detection allows healthcare providers to implement targeted therapies, including CFTR modulators and supportive care, which can slow disease progression and improve outcomes. This proactive approach not only enhances patient outcomes but also expands the market for CF therapeutics by increasing the number of diagnosed patients requiring ongoing management and treatment.

Global Cystic Fibrosis Therapeutics Company News

 

The CF Foundation invested $15 million in ReCode Therapeutics in Jan 2023. ReCode specializes in growing advanced shipping methods for mRNA and gene correction therapeutics, primarily focusing on an inhaled mRNA-based totally remedy for Cystic Fibrosis.

 

Dec 2022, Vertex Pharmaceuticals acquired FDA clearance for VX-522, an mRNA treatment for CF lung disease. A clinical trial for CF sufferers is expected soon.

 

In August 2021, Sanofi acquired Translate Bio for $3.2 billion. Translate Bio specializes in developing drugs for cystic Fibrosis and rare pulmonary diseases.

 

In Nov 2021, Eloxx Pharma introduced a Phase 2 medical trial of ELX-02 in CF Class 1.

 

In October 2020, Roche and Abbvie obtained the product portfolio for TMEM 16A to decorate their product variety.

 

In November 2020, Polyphor reached a deal with the Cystic Fibrosis Foundation to develop inhaled murepavadin for CF patients.

 

In December 2020, Researchers at Hopkins University and Medicine developed a new antibiotic to combat drug-resistant pathogens like Mycobacterium abscesses, which can damage humans with cystic Fibrosis or lung sicknesses.

 

In April 2019, The FDA authorized KALYDECO by using Vertex Pharmaceuticals. This expands treatment alternatives for children with cystic Fibrosis as young as six months old, probably changing the disease's progression.
